Turbo Tie Rod Installation

Finally getting around to installing turbo tie rods. Removed the drivers side and here's what I found.

The old one is significantly shorter than the new one with the spacer. Is it ok to remove the spacer? Should I fabricate a thinner spacer?

gotta use the spacer. they're adjustable for length, so put them on, and then adjust the toe.

One more question. The new boots are both very long but the old one on the passenger side is very short. Is there a trick or modification I need to know about?

remove the tie rod ends, and attach the tierods and spacers to the rack first, then spray the boots with wet style silicone spray and work them on. then reinstall the ends. a 90° hook tool helps get the boot onto the rack. the old metal spring clamps are not used.
